Datenquellen (Reportverwaltung)
Über den Menüpunkt "Daten" können eigene Datenquellen definiert werden, die dann für diesen Report zur Verfügung stehen. Die Definition einer eigenen Datenquelle erfolgt über SQL-Befehle, mit denen beispielsweise einzelne Felder aus einer Tabelle selektiert, mehrere Tabellen miteinander verknüpft, Daten gruppiert oder sortiert werden können.
Anlegen einer eigenen Datenquelle
Nach dem Wechsel in den Reiter "Daten" erscheint zunächst eine leere Seite, sofern der Report noch keine eigene Datenquelle enthält. Um nun eine eigene Datenquelle zu definieren, wählt man Daten-> neu. Nun stehen dem Anwender ein Abfrageassistent und ein Abfrageeditor zur Verfügung.
Der Abfrageassistent ist ein visuelles Hilfsmittel, um SQL-Befehle automatisch zu generieren. Diese können anschließend noch angepasst werden.
Schritt 1: Im ersten Schritt können eine oder mehrere bereits bestehende Datenquellen ausgewählt werden, deren Inhalte in der neuen Datenquelle mit einbezogen werden sollen. Möchte man beispielsweise den Schülernamen in den neuen Datenquelle zur Verfügung haben, muss hier die Tabelle Schüler verwenden. Über den Pfeil, kann eine verfügbare Tabelle nach rechts in die Auflistung der gewählten Tabellen verschoben werden. (Bild1) Sobald zwei Tabellen ausgewählt werden, öffnet sich ein separates Fenster, indem angegeben werden muss, wie die Tabellen miteinander verknüpft werden (JOIN-Befehl). Standardmäßig wird hier ein "InnerJoin" vorgeschlagen und die Tabellen werden über die passenden Schlüsselfelder miteinander verknüpft.
Sortierung und Gruppierung der Felder zu wählen. Es kann also zeitsparend sein, einen Bericht erst mit dem Berichtsassistenten zu erzeugen und direkt zu verwenden oder gegebenenfalls nur noch etwas anzupassen.
Der Abfrageassistent